How to prepare for a job interview at JobLeads GmbH
✨Brush Up on Coding Challenges
Since the role involves tackling coding challenges similar to those on platforms like LeetCode and HackerRank, make sure to practice a variety of problems in your preferred programming language. This will help you demonstrate your problem-solving skills during the interview.
✨Know Your Projects
Be prepared to discuss your previous projects in detail. Highlight your contributions, the technologies you used, and any challenges you faced. This shows your practical experience and ability to apply your skills effectively.
✨Understand the Company’s Tech Stack
Research the technologies and frameworks that the company uses. Familiarising yourself with their tech stack will allow you to tailor your answers and show how your skills align with their needs.
✨Prepare Questions for the Interviewers
Having thoughtful questions ready for your interviewers can set you apart. Ask about the team dynamics, project methodologies, or future technology plans. This demonstrates your genuine interest in the role and the company.
